Understanding PVA Chemicals: What You Need to Know

Polyvinyl alcohol (PVA) is a synthetic polymer that boasts a variety of practical applications across numerous industries. As an exceptional water-soluble compound, it plays a pivotal role in many processes, making it one of the most versatile materials in the chemical sector. 1. PVA in Adhesives and Sealants

One of the most prominent uses of PVA chemicals is in the production of adhesives and sealants. PVA-based adhesives are favored for their strong bonding properties and non-toxic nature, making them ideal for applications in woodworking, packaging, and textiles.

For instance, in woodworking, PVA glue offers excellent adhesion to porous surfaces, enabling artisans to create durable products. If you're engaged in woodworking, opt for a PVA glue suitable for your specific project, whether it involves bonding wood, paper, or fabric.

2. PVA as a Film Former

PVA chemicals are highly valued in the cosmetics and personal care industries due to their ability to form a transparent film. This characteristic is particularly beneficial in products such as hair sprays, moisturizers, and other topical applications.

The film-forming properties of PVA allow for a protective layer that retains moisture and enhances product durability. For instance, in a hair styling product, PVA can help maintain a hairstyle without leaving residue. 3. PVA in Textile Applications

Another key area where PVA chemicals shine is in the textile industry. Thanks to their water-soluble nature, PVA is commonly used in sizing agents for fabrics. This helps improve the strength of yarns during weaving while allowing for easy removal post-manufacturing.

Additionally, PVA serves as a binder in non-woven textile applications, offering a means to create textiles that are both durable and soft. For textile manufacturers, implementing PVA in their production processes can lead to enhanced quality and performance.

4. PVA in Construction and Building Materials

PVA chemicals are also gaining traction in the construction sector, where they are utilized in the formulation of cement and concrete products. PVA-based additives enhance the water retention and workability of these materials, leading to improved strength and durability.

For example, when mixed with concrete, PVA improves flexibility and reduces cracking, thereby prolonging the lifespan of structures. Contractors and builders should consider integrating PVA into their concrete mixes to optimize structural performance.

5. Common Questions About PVA Chemicals

What are the environmental impacts of PVA chemicals?

PVA is generally considered environmentally friendly, as it is biodegradable under certain conditions. However, the impact can vary based on application and disposal practices. Always consult local regulations regarding disposal.

Can PVA chemicals be used in food packaging?

Yes, PVA is utilized in some food packaging applications due to its safe, non-toxic profile. However, ensure that the PVA used complies with food safety standards.

Is PVA safe for skin contact?

PVA is commonly used in personal care products and is considered safe for skin contact in concentrations typically used in commercial formulations. Always perform a patch test for new products.
